Antique Denco Silver Hunter Pocket Watch, Military

1900 - 1920
Description

Antique Denco silver half hunter pocket watch, military history.

The watch has a Swiss 15-jewel stem-winding movement which is working nicely. The movement is signed Denco Watch Co, a brand name registered by the Dennison Watch Case Company in 1915. Up until then the company had concentrated on manufacturing watch cases, supplying various watch companies and of course Waltham UK. However production temporarily ceased at the start of World War II when the company starting manufacturing military equipment for the British Royal Air commenced.

The movement is protected by an inner hinged cover which has a charming inscription, ‘The Royal Borough of Kensington, Horse Parade, 1928, (long service horse & man), First Prize, A E Botwright’.

This is believed to be Albert E Botwright, born in 1898 in St Katherines Road, Kensington. Albert enlisted at the age of 19, (Fulham) Brigade Royal Field Artillery Driver.

The watch measures 50mm diameter excluding the winding stem and the loop. The case is silver and there are hallmarks inside the three outer covers for Birmingham 1924 with a case maker’s mark for Dennison Watch Company. Overall, the case is in good condition for such an early piece, light surface marks and a hint of unevenness to the hinged case back.

The front cover has a small central lens surrounded by dark blue enamel filled Roman numerals. The winding crown pushes in to open the front cover. Inside, there is a glass lens which is in lovely condition.

The dial is signed with the name of the original retailer, The Alex Clark Co, London and also with the name Denco. The Alexander Clark Manufacturing Company was originally a silversmith and silver plate manufacturer established in 1890. The company opened up its first shop in Sheffield in 1900 and went on to have three shops in London, and offered items manufactured in-house and items bought in for retail.

The dial is in lovely condition and has blued steel hands, including the special half hunter hour hand so that the time can be read when the front cover is closed.

The watch comes with a single chain, 36cm long including the T-bar and the clasp... this came to us with the watch. Each of the links on the chain has a good clear lion mark. The T-bar and clasp are also hallmarked for Chester 1930 and 1927 respectively.

The watch and chain come in a new presentation box.
